Relevant Drafts of the Agreement
Importance:
High
Ili
— Here are the first set of agreements that we proposed. They were drafted on September 6th. The plea
ag
nt (where he pleads to a federal charge) contains nothing about section 2255. The Non-Prosecution
Agreement contains the following:
4.
Epstein agrees that, if any of the victims identified in the federal investigation file suit
pursuant to 18 U.S.C. § 2255, Epstein will not contest the jurisdiction of the U.S. District
Court for the Southern District of Florida over his person and/or the subject matter, and
Epstein will not contest that the identified victims are persons who, while minors, were
victims of violations of Title IS, United States Code, Sections(s) 2422 and/or 2423.
5.
The United States shall provide Epstein's attorneys with a list of the identified victims,
which will not exceed forty, after Epstein has signed this agreement and entered his
guilty plea. The United States shall make a motion with the United States District Court
for the Southern District of Florida for the appointment of a guardian ad litem for the
identified victims and Epstein's counsel may contact the identified victims through that
counsel.
At the beginning, Epstein was most interested in pleading to a federal charge, so we spent a lot of time on the
federal plea agreement. This identical language was incorporated into the proposed federal plea agreement. I
have I I drafts of the plea agreement on my computer, they all have the identical language on this point.
Around mid-September, we went back to the Non-Prosecution Agreement.
On September IC. Jay proposed the following language:
Epstein agrees to fund a Trust set up in concert with the Government and under the supervision of the
15th Judicial Circuit in and for Palm Beach County. Epstein agrees that a Trustee will be appointed by
the Circuit Court and that funds from the Trust will be available to be disbursed at the Trustee's
discretion to an agreed list of persons who seek reimbursement and make a good faith showing to the
Trustee that they suffered injury as a result of the conduct of Epstein. Epstein waives his right to contest
liability or damages up to an amount agreed to by the parties for any settlements entered into by the
Trustee. Epstein's waiver is not to be construed as an admission of civil or criminal liability in regards
to any of those who seek compensation from the Trust.
I sent an e-mail to Jay on September 18th, with the following response:
Re your paragraph 8: As I mentioned over the telephone, I cannot bind the girls to the Trust
Agreement. and I don't think it is appropriate that a state court would administer a trust that seeks to
pay for federal civil claims. We both want to avoid unscrupulous attorneys and/or litigants from
coming forward, and I know that your client wants to keep these matters outside of public court filings,
but I just don't have the power to do what you ask. Here is nherecommendation. During the period
between Mr. Epstein's plea and sentencing, I make a motion for appointment of the Guardian Ad

Litem. The three of us sit down and discuss things, and I will facilitate as much as I can getting the
girls' approval of this procedure because, as I mentioned, I think it is probably in their best interests.
In terms of plea agreement language, let me suggest the following:
The United States agrees to make a motion seeking the appointment of a Guardian ad Litem to
represent the identified victims. Following the appointment of such Guardian, the parties agree to
work together in good faith to develop a Trust Agreement, subject to the Courts approval, that would
provide for any damages owed to the identified victims pursuant to 18 U.S.C. Section 2255. Then
include the last two sentences of your paragraph 8.
NOTICE that I offered to try to put together a Trust Agreement.
On September I8'h, Jay sent a proposed agreement that made no mention at all of payments to the victims.
Jay sent the following redline on September 2l s:

On September 23w, at around 8:00 p.m., the language was:
•
6.
The United States shall provide Epstein's attorneys with a list of individuals whom
it has identified as victims, as defined in 18 U.S.C. § 2255, after Epstein has
signed this agreement and been sentenced. Upon the execution of this agreement,
the United States will file a motion with the United States District Court for the
Southern District of Florida for the appointment of a guardian ad litem for these
persons. Epstein's counsel may contact the identified individuals through that
guardian.
7.
If any of the individuals referred to in paragraph (6), supra, elects to file suit
pursuant to 18 U.S.C. § 2255, Epstein will not contest the jurisdiction of the
United States District Court for the Southern District of Florida over his person
and/or the subject matter, and Epstein waives his right to contest liability and also
waives his right to contest damages up to an amount as agreed to between the
identified victim and Epstein, so long as the identified victim elects to proceed
exclusively under 18 U.S.C. § 2255, and agrees to waive any other claim for
damages, whether pursuant to state, federal, or common law. Notwithstanding this
waiver, as to those individuals whose names appear on the list provided by the
United States, Epstein's signature on this agreement is not to be construed as an
admission of any criminal or civil liability other than that contained in 18 U.S.C. §
2255.

8.
Epstein's signature on this agreement also is not to be construed as an admission
of civil or criminal liability or a waiver of any jurisdictional or other defense as to
any person whose name does not appear on the list provided by the United States.
At the end of the day on September 24th, at
request, there were several significant changes. Here
is the new language:
O
7.
The United States shall provide Epstein's attorneys with a list of individuals whom
it has identified as victims, as defined in 18 U.S.C. § 2255, after Epstein has
signed this agreement and been sentenced. Upon the execution of this agreement,
the United States, in consultation with and subject to the good faith approval of
Epstein's counsel, shall select an attorney representative for these persons, who
shall be paid for by Epstein. Epstein's counsel may contact the identified
individuals through that representative.
8.
If any of the individuals referred to in paragraph (7), supra, elects to file suit
pursuant to 18 U.S.C. § 2255, Epstein will not contest the jurisdiction of the
United States District Court for the Southern District of Florida over his person
and/or the subject matter, and Epstein waives his right to contest liability and also
waives his right to contest damages up to an amount as agreed to between the
identified individual and Epstein, so long as the identified individual elects to
proceed exclusively under 18 U.S.C. § 2255, and agrees to waive any other claim
for damages, whether pursuant to state, federal, or common law. Notwithstanding
this waiver, as to those individuals whose names appear on the list provided by the
United States, Epstein's signature on this agreement, his waivers and failures to
contest liability and such damages in any suit are not to be construed as an
admission of any criminal or civil liability.
9.
Epstein's signature on this agreement also is not to be construed as an admission
of civil or criminal liability or a waiver of any jurisdictional or other defense as to
any person whose name does not appear on the list provided by the United States.
10.
Except as to those individuals who elect to proceed exclusively under 18 U.S.C. §
2255, as set forth in paragraph (8), supra, neither Epstein's signature on this agreement, nor its
terms, nor any resulting waivers or settlements by Epstein are to be construed as admissions or
evidence of civil or criminal liability or a waiver of any jurisdictional or other defense as to any
person, whether or not her name appears on the list provided by the United States.
This was the final language.
